How old is Kucherov?
Tampa Bay Lightning winger Nikita Kucherov turns 28 years old, making it nearly 10 years since he was drafted into the organization. Since his debut, Kucherov has accumulated 221 goals and 547 points in 515 regular season games. And in the playoffs, he has 41 goals and 117 points in 103 games.

Who is the tallest NHL player ever?

Standing 2.04 m (6 ft 9 in) tall, defenceman Zdeno Chara (Slovakia) of the Boston Bruins (USA) is the tallest player in NHL history.

What is Nikita Kucherov’s injury?

The cross-check he took in Game 6 of the semifinal lingered until the end of the Stanley Cup run. TAMPA — Nikita Kucherov played the final six games of the Lightning’s Stanley Cup run with a cracked rib that had knocked him out of Game 6 of the semifinal round, his agent Dan Milstein confirmed Friday.

What nationality is Steven Stamkos?

Steven Christopher Stamkos (born February 7, 1990) is a Canadian professional ice hockey centre and alternate captain for the Tampa Bay Lightning of the National Hockey League (NHL). Stamkos was the first overall pick in the 2006 OHL Entry Draft, from the Markham Waxers of the OMHA.

Who has the most hat tricks in NHL history?

The most hat-tricks scored in an NHL career is 50 by Wayne Gretzky (Canada), for the Edmonton Oilers, Los Angeles Kings, St Louis Blues and New York Rangers between 1979 and 1999.
